Blood Pressure Monitor
The blood pressure monitor is a key component of the blood circulation simulation and testing system. It can accurately monitor and control blood pressure, providing essential data support for vascular interventional device testing, functional demonstration, procedural demonstration, and training. These modules are typically used in conjunction with simulated vascular platforms to replicate dynamic human blood flow, including real-time monitoring and analysis of blood pressure. Equipped with high-precision sensors and advanced algorithms, the fluid pressure monitoring module delivers continuous, real-time pressure readings, assisting researchers and medical professionals in better understanding and mastering hemodynamic characteristics.

Technical Highlights
Product Features
Real-time Monitoring
Compatible with various vascular simulation platforms, enabling real-time monitoring of intravascular blood flow conditions.
Safety Simulation
Capable of simulating different blood pressure conditions during the testing and evaluation of vascular interventional devices, ensuring the performance and safety of surgical instruments under various clinical scenarios.
High Fidelity
Can serve as an auxiliary device to achieve high-fidelity simulation in vascular model testing platforms.
Multi-channel Measurement
Able to simultaneously measure blood flow pressure at multiple vascular points with independent channels, ensuring high accuracy and stability without interference between channels.

Customization
Channel customization: The number of channels can be customized;
Pressure Range Customization: customizable testing pressure range and accuracy;
Software customization: Different analysis software can be customized.

Parameters
Type | Blood Pressure Monitor |
Image | ![]() |
Model | XPS06 |
Channel quantity | 6 Channels |
| Sampling frequency | 10HZ |
Pressure Measurement Range | 0-250mmHg |
Precision | ±1.5% |
Resolution | 1mmHg |
Data export | SD Card Export |
Dimensions | 0.8*0.4*0.3ft |
